1

1. A method of managing communication of data by a wireless networking device, the method being operable on a computerized device with a processor and memory, the method comprising the steps of: (a) analyzing a state of the wireless networking device to determine whether the data is communicable over a wireless network in compliance with a performance threshold; (b) analyzing a zone in which the wireless networking device that is not in compliance with the performance threshold is located to detect a condition that relates to the communication of the data in the zone, wherein the data is communicable by the wireless networking device and a peripheral wireless networking device in the zone; (c) measuring a degree of the condition that affects the communication by the wireless networking device that is not in compliance with the performance threshold from being in compliance with the performance threshold; (d) determining a solution to affect the degree of the condition; and (e) controlling the wireless networking device to apply the solution.
